Elaine "Bugsy" A. Willemin Portland and Crystal Age 77, beloved mother, grandmother passed away on July 30, 2010. She was born on July 15, 1933 the daughter of Paul and Sena (Peterson) Spohn. Bugsy was a member of St. Patrick Church in Portland and a member of St. Mary's Church in Carson City. She enjoyed baking, sewing and crafts and playing bridge for many years. She was a member of the Model A Club and the Crystal Art Festival Committee. On May 22, 1954 she married William F. Willemin and together they raised 5 sons. Bugsy was preceded in death by her husband, Bill in 2009; her parents; stepmother, Elaine Spohn; brother, Larry Spohn. Surviving are her sons Dr. Russ (Kathy) Willemin, Denny (Meg) Willemin, Dr. Doug (Laura) Willemin, Mike (Shari) Willemin, and John (Chris) Willemin; 15 grandchildren; 9 great grandchildren; siblings V.A. (Al) Goodrich, Doreen (Jack) Warder, Diane (Dennis) Goff, Dan (Margo) Spohn, Don (Karen) Spohn and Debbie (Dan) Grohs; very special sister-in-law, Ellen (Ted) Lentz; sister-in-law, Jan Trierweiler; many nieces and nephews.
